The Role

As part of the Privacy Engineering team at Google DeepMind, you will play a key role in creating innovative privacy-preserving technologies for GenAI-based agents!

GenAI agents are increasingly used to handle sensitive data on behalf of users. For them to operate in a secure, trustworthy, and reliable manner, there are many unsolved, impactful problems including:

  • Private inference using large GenAI models (e.g. Gemini)
  • Private AI agent memory supporting user’s multi-modal data
  • Developing privacy preserving agentic capabilities such as tool use 
  • New agent architectures that offer privacy-by-design in realistic deployment scenarios

We are looking for a Software Engineer to join the Google DeepMind Privacy Engineering team to work on a new private inference infrastructure for Google DeepMind and our product partners. ML experience is not required for this role and it will not involve training ML models.

Key responsibilities:

You will be contributing to an ambitious Private Inference project. This includes building infrastructure, researching new privacy preserving methods, working with partner and client teams, and most importantly, land transformative impact for GDM and our product partners.

  • Invent and implement novel protocols and APIs to build private-by-design distributed systems at Google scale
  • Work on low-level components to reduce the Trusted Computing Base of the system, including open source and proprietary components (in Rust, C++, Java and Kotlin)
  • Understand the tradeoffs between different encryption schemes and apply them to existing and new systems
  • Reason about the properties of distributed systems holistically as components are added to it (e.g. accelerators, persistent memory, etc.)
  • Define threat models for existing and new systems, taking into account engineering trade-offs and product requirements
  • Think adversarially about the software and hardware stack, and figure out how to mitigate potential attack vectors
  • Implement workloads running on Trusted Execution Environments (TEE, a.k.a. Enclaves)
  • Design and build a transparent and secured storage system for LLM servers.
  • Work with product teams, gather requirements and provide solutions to help deliver value incrementally
  • Amplify the impact by generalizing solutions into reusable libraries and frameworks for privacy preserving AI agents across Google, and by sharing knowledge through design docs, open source, external blog posts and white papers

What We Do

We’re a team of scientists, engineers, machine learning experts and more, working together to advance the state of the art in artificial intelligence. We use our technologies for widespread public benefit and scientific discovery, and collaborate with others on critical challenges, ensuring safety and ethics are the highest priority.

Our long term aim is to solve intelligence, developing more general and capable problem-solving systems, known as artificial general intelligence (AGI).

Guided by safety and ethics, this invention could help society find answers to some of the world’s most pressing and fundamental scientific challenges.

We have a track record of breakthroughs in fundamental AI research, published in journals like Nature, Science, and more.Our programs have learned to diagnose eye diseases as effectively as the world’s top doctors, to save 30% of the energy used to keep data centres cool, and to predict the complex 3D shapes of proteins - which could one day transform how drugs are invented.
